Browsing Group First-Person Videos with 3D Visualization
説明
This work presents a novel user interface applying 3D visualization to understand complex group activities from multiple first-person videos. The proposed interface is designed to assist video viewers to easily understand the collaborative relationships of group activity based on where the individual worker is located in a workspace and how multiple workers are positioned to one another during the group activity. More specifically, the interface not only shows all recorded first-person videos but also visualizes the 3D position and orientation of each view point (i.e., the 3D position of each worker wearing a head-mounted camera) with a reconstructed 3D model of the workspace. Our user study confirms that the 3D visualization helps video viewers to understand geometric information of a worker and collaborative relationships of group activity easily and accurately.
